Eserver pSeries 690 Doors and Covers

Covers are an integral part of the Eserver pSeries 690 and are required for product safety and EMC
compliance. The following rear door options are available for the Eserver pSeries 690:
v "Enhanced Acoustical" Cover Option
This feature provides a low-noise option for customers or sites with stringent acoustical requirements
and where a minimal system footprint is not critical. The Acoustical cover option consists of a special
rear door which is approximately 200-mm (8 in.) in depth and contains acoustical treatment that lowers
the noise level of the machine by approximately 6 dB compared to the non-acoustical rear door. With
this option, the 7040 meets the acoustical Specifications for Category 1A for Data Processing Areas,

v "Slimline" Cover Option
This feature provides a smaller-footprint and lower-cost option for customers or sites where space is
more critical than acoustical noise levels. The Slimline cover option consists of rear door which is about
50-mm (2 in.) in depth with no acoustical treatment. With this option, the 7040 has a declared
